- Honor Magic V5 - méret a kamera mögött
- Samsung Galaxy S26 - szeret, nem szeret
- Újabb renderek mutatják meg az Xperia 1 VIII változásait
- Fotók, videók mobillal
- Nothing Phone 2a - semmi nem drága
- OnePlus 15 - van plusz energia
- Xiaomi 17 Ultra - jó az optikája
- Realme GT 2 - aláírjuk
- Marketingképeken a Motorola Edge 70 Pro
- Okosóra és okoskiegészítő topik
Új hozzászólás Aktív témák
-
nyunyu
félisten
válasz
DeFranco
#4708
üzenetére
Jó, de hogy csatolod az aliasolt alqueryket a fő queryhez?
CTE szintaxissal libasorban?
with k as
(select munkavallalo, ...
from ...
where ...),
khd as (
select munkavallalo, ...
from ...
where ...),
ahd as (
select munkavallalo, ...
from ...
where ...),
kh as (
select munkavallalo, ...
from ...
where ...)
-- innentol a "fo" query
SELECT
K.[munkavállaló] "MUNK"
KHD.[érték]/AHD.[érték] AS "KPERA"
KH.[hónapazonosító] AS "HO"
FROM K
JOIN KHD
ON KHD.munkavallalo = K.munkavallalo
JOIN AHD
ON AHD.munkavallalo = K.munkavallalo
JOIN KH
ON KH.munkavallalo = K.munkavallalo
)
PIVOT
(
SUM(KPERA)
FOR HO IN (...)
)Vagy oldschool módon?
SELECT
K.[munkavállaló] "MUNK"
KHD.[érték]/AHD.[érték] AS "KPERA"
KH.[hónapazonosító] AS "HO"
FROM (select munkavallalo, ...
from ...
where ...) K
JOIN (select munkavallalo, ...
from ...
where ...) KHD
ON KHD.munkavallalo = K.munkavallalo
JOIN (select munkavallalo, ...
from ...
where ...) AHD
ON AHD.munkavallalo = K.munkavallalo
JOIN (select munkavallalo, ...
from ...
where ...) KH
ON KH.munkavallalo = K.munkavallalo
)
PIVOT
(
SUM(KPERA)
FOR HO IN (...)
)Elvileg mindkettő szabványos, menniük kellene.
(Még oldschoolabb, FROM után vesszővel felsorolt () K, () KH, () KHD, () AHD majd WHERE után a join feltételek szintaxis az nem szabványos, nem minden DB ismeri.
Az valami Teradata hagyaték lehet a JOIN szabványosítása előttről?)
Új hozzászólás Aktív témák
- Szép! HP EliteBook 855 G7 Fémházas Strapabíró Laptop 15,6" -65% AMD Ryzen 3 PRO 4450U 16/256 FHD
- HP 250RG10 3-100U 15 8GB/512 PC (B9YG6ET) Bontatlan (2db)
- Radiomaster TX16S MAX Mark II ELRS táv
- thrustmaster ts pc racer ferrari 488 challenge edition
- HP EliteBook 655 G10 15" Ryzen 5 PRO 7530U 32GB RAM Garancia 2028.02.27.
- S21 256/8 dobozában
- Részletfizetés.Bontatlan. Gamer szék noblechairs HERO PU Bőr fekete/fekete 24 hónap garancia.
- 152 - Lenovo LOQ (15IRH8) - Intel Core i5-12450H, RTX 4060 (ELKELT)
- AKCIÓ! Gigabyte Gaming RTX 3060Ti 8GB videokártya garanciával hibátlan működéssel
- Apple Watch Series 7 GPS+Cellular, 45mm (MKJP3HC/A) Éjfekete aluminium tok, éjfekete sport szíj
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est

